Home
last modified time | relevance | path

Searched refs:UrgentWatermark (Results 1 – 11 of 11) sorted by relevance

/openbsd/sys/dev/pci/drm/amd/display/dc/dml/
H A Ddisplay_mode_structs.h68 double UrgentWatermark; member
H A Ddisplay_mode_vba.h548 double UrgentWatermark; member
H A Ddisplay_mode_vba.c89 dml_get_attr_func(wm_urgent, mode_lib->vba.UrgentWatermark);
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n30/
H A Ddisplay_mode_vba_30.c348 double *UrgentWatermark,
2795 &v->UrgentWatermark, in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2943 v->UrgentWatermark));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2949 v->UrgentWatermark);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2953 v->MinTTUVBlank[k] = v->UrgentWatermark; in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
5068 &v->UrgentWatermark, in dml30_ModeSupportAndSystemConfigurationFull()
5240 double *UrgentWatermark, in CalculateWatermarksAndDRAMSpeedChangeSupport()
5275 *UrgentWatermark = UrgentLatency + ExtraLatency; in CalculateWatermarksAndDRAMSpeedChangeSupport()
5277 *DRAMClockChangeWatermark = DRAMClockChangeLatency + *UrgentWatermark; in CalculateWatermarksAndDRAMSpeedChangeSupport()
5320 …ncyMarginY = EffectiveLBLatencyHidingY + FullDETBufferingTimeY[k] - *UrgentWatermark - (HTotal[k] … in CalculateWatermarksAndDRAMSpeedChangeSupport()
[all …]
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n21/
H A Ddisplay_mode_vba_21.c335 double *UrgentWatermark,
2467 &mode_lib->vba.UrgentWatermark, in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2572 mode_lib->vba.UrgentWatermark));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2578 mode_lib->vba.UrgentWatermark);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2582 locals->MinTTUVBlank[k] = mode_lib->vba.UrgentWatermark; in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
5037 &mode_lib->vba.UrgentWatermark, in dml21_ModeSupportAndSystemConfigurationFull()
5292 double *UrgentWatermark, in CalculateWatermarksAndDRAMSpeedChangeSupport()
5336 *UrgentWatermark = UrgentLatency + ExtraLatency; in CalculateWatermarksAndDRAMSpeedChangeSupport()
5338 *DRAMClockChangeWatermark = DRAMClockChangeLatency + *UrgentWatermark; in CalculateWatermarksAndDRAMSpeedChangeSupport()
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n32/
H A Ddisplay_mode_vba_32.c1226 v->UrgentWatermark = v->Watermark.UrgentWatermark; in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1370 v->Watermark.UrgentWatermark);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1374 v->Watermark.StutterEnterPlusExitWatermark, v->Watermark.UrgentWatermark);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1378 v->Watermark.UrgentWatermark); in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1380 v->MinTTUVBlank[k] = v->Watermark.UrgentWatermark; in D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
3753 mode_lib->vba.UrgentWatermark = mode_lib->vba.Watermark.UrgentWatermark; in dml32_ModeSupportAndSystemConfigurationFull()
H A Ddisplay_mode_vba_util_32.c4324 v->Watermark.UrgentWatermark = mmSOCParameters.UrgentLatency + mmSOCParameters.ExtraLatency; in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
4327 …k.DRAMClockChangeWatermark = mmSOCParameters.DRAMClockChangeLatency + v->Watermark.UrgentWatermark; in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
4328 …->Watermark.FCLKChangeWatermark = mmSOCParameters.FCLKChangeLatency + v->Watermark.UrgentWatermark; in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
4342 dml_print("DML::%s: UrgentWatermark = %f\n", __func__, v->Watermark.UrgentWatermark); in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
4461 …tiveDRAMClockChangeLatencyMargin[k] = ActiveClockChangeLatencyHiding - v->Watermark.UrgentWatermark in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
4463 ActiveFCLKChangeLatencyMargin[k] = ActiveClockChangeLatencyHiding - v->Watermark.UrgentWatermark in dml32_CalculateWatermarksMALLUseAndDRAMSpeedChangeSupport()
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n20/
H A Ddisplay_mode_vba_20v2.c1518 mode_lib->vba.UrgentWatermark = mode_lib->vba.UrgentLatencyPixelDataOnly in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1523 DTRACE(" wm_urgent = %fus", mode_lib->vba.UrgentWatermark); in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1544 + mode_lib->vba.UrgentWatermark; in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1809 - mode_lib->vba.UrgentWatermark; in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2413 mode_lib->vba.UrgentWatermark)); in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2419 mode_lib->vba.UrgentWatermark); in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2423 mode_lib->vba.MinTTUVBlank[k] = mode_lib->vba.UrgentWatermark; in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2644 dml_max(mode_lib->vba.StutterEnterPlusExitWatermark, mode_lib->vba.UrgentWatermark)) in dml20v2_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
H A Ddisplay_mode_vba_20.c1482 mode_lib->vba.UrgentWatermark = mode_lib->vba.UrgentLatencyPixelDataOnly in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1487 DTRACE(" wm_urgent = %fus", mode_lib->vba.UrgentWatermark); in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1508 + mode_lib->vba.UrgentWatermark; in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
1773 - mode_lib->vba.UrgentWatermark; in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2379 mode_lib->vba.UrgentWatermark)); in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2385 mode_lib->vba.UrgentWatermark); in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
2389 mode_lib->vba.MinTTUVBlank[k] = mode_lib->vba.UrgentWatermark; in dml20_DISPCLKDPPCLKDCFCLKDeepSleepPrefetchParametersWatermarksAndPerformanceCalculation()
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n31/
H A Ddisplay_mode_vba_31.c3099 dml_max(v->StutterEnterPlusExitWatermark, v->UrgentWatermark));
3103 v->MinTTUVBlank[k] = dml_max(v->StutterEnterPlusExitWatermark, v->UrgentWatermark);
3107 v->MinTTUVBlank[k] = v->UrgentWatermark;
5599 v->UrgentWatermark = UrgentLatency + ExtraLatency;
5604 dml_print("DML::%s: UrgentWatermark = %f\n", __func__, v->UrgentWatermark);
5607 v->DRAMClockChangeWatermark = v->DRAMClockChangeLatency + v->UrgentWatermark;
5672 …l[k] + v->DSTYAfterScaler[k]) * v->HTotal[k] / v->PixelClock[k] - v->UrgentWatermark - v->DRAMCloc…
5681 …l[k] + v->DSTYAfterScaler[k]) * v->HTotal[k] / v->PixelClock[k] - v->UrgentWatermark - v->DRAMCloc…
/openbsd/sys/dev/pci/drm/amd/display/dc/dml/dcn314/
H A Ddisplay_mode_vba_314.c3120 dml_max(v->StutterEnterPlusExitWatermark, v->UrgentWatermark));
3124 v->MinTTUVBlank[k] = dml_max(v->StutterEnterPlusExitWatermark, v->UrgentWatermark);
3128 v->MinTTUVBlank[k] = v->UrgentWatermark;
5694 v->UrgentWatermark = UrgentLatency + ExtraLatency;
5699 dml_print("DML::%s: UrgentWatermark = %f\n", __func__, v->UrgentWatermark);
5702 v->DRAMClockChangeWatermark = v->DRAMClockChangeLatency + v->UrgentWatermark;
5767 …l[k] + v->DSTYAfterScaler[k]) * v->HTotal[k] / v->PixelClock[k] - v->UrgentWatermark - v->DRAMCloc…
5776 …l[k] + v->DSTYAfterScaler[k]) * v->HTotal[k] / v->PixelClock[k] - v->UrgentWatermark - v->DRAMCloc…